The ingredients needed to make Toddler Friendly Green Noodle Soup:
- Get 1/2 zucchini, finely shredded
- Make ready 3 cups water
- Get 1.5 tbsp chicken bouillon powder (or 1 cube)
- Get 2 eggs scrambled
- Make ready 1 pkg instant ramen noodles(toss the pkg of powder in the trash)

Instructions to make Toddler Friendly Green Noodle Soup:
- Bring the water and chicken soup seasoning to a boil.
- Once its boiling, drop in the rest of the ingredients. Cook for 5 min or until noodles are cooked to your liking then serve♡
- My 2 year old scrambled the eggs in a bowl and helped shred the zucchini. If you let them help in the kitchen they're more likely to eat the meal. He LOVED this soup!
